WebBitter Beck Pottery. Bitter Beck Pottery is the open studio of pottery Joan Hardie, who designs, makes and sells her work on the premises. Joan's ceramics are inspired by colours, textures and forms found in nature, particularly trees, bark and fungi. Her range includes vases, bowls and dishes, wind chimes and wall pieces. WebBitterbeck About An easy-going bunch of folkie friends who perform original songs with wit and flair, often with environmental themes. Angie Power (vox), Cathy Grout (bass, vox), Dave Camlin (guitar, vox) and Keith Fitton (guitar, vox) formed a social ‘bubble’ to make music to get through lockdown together, and then we kept on playing.
